Where does the time go. I sat and remembered it
was 40 years ago that I was packing my JOE NAMATH
image and few things for departure to VIET NAM. I
was to report APRIL 1 1968 for orientation &
departure to VIET NAM. Funny a friend of our
gang was named APRIL. [small world]
I said, good-bye to CAMILLE her sister JO & MOM
& DAD. My friends took me out for beers &
party time. Today, I still live with the memos.
I arrived in VIET NAM APRIL 3 if my memo is correct.
It was a different time and a different America.
J.F.K. said, do something for your country, so I did.
Time and tied waits for no man. So the tides flow in
every-ones life. FATE - of GOD I guess was part of it all.
